摘要
A chimeric gene containing the beta-glucuronidase (GUS) coding sequence fused to the maize histone H4C7 gene promoter was expressed in transient assays in tobacco mesophyll protoplasts revealing the replication-independent activity of the plant histone gene promoter. Functional analysis of 5' deletions of the H4C7 promoter suggested the presence of antagonistic activities in a region encompassing the plant histone-specific octamer and a hybrid hexameric motif, and revealed an essential cis-acting positive element between nucleotides -82 and -36 relative to the TATA box. Furthermore, point mutations introduced in the CCATCGAAC motif present in this region drastically reduced the activity of the H4C7 promoter. We conclude this nonameric sequence, present in the 5' flanking DNA sequence of most plant histone genes, to be a positive cis-acting element controlling the basal replication-independent activity of the H4C7 promoter.
